Description
Gives full weight to the part played by the Einsatzgruppen - the professional killing squads deployed in Poland and the Soviet Union, early in the War, by Himmler's SS. Shows how these squads were utilized as the Nazis made two separate plans for dealing with the civilian populations they wanted to destroy
